Kogan was founded by entrepreneur Ruslan Kogan 25 years ago in Australia as an online own-brand electrical goods retailer. Since then it's grown into a huge company, selling a wide range of products on its NZ and OZ websites.
Here in Aotearoa, it owns online retailer MightyApe.co.nz. However, despite its size, the Kogan Mobile brand is still a small player in the market. But it's deserving of greater attention, because if you're after a cheap, no-frills phone plan, Kogan Mobile's pre-paid deals are some of the cheapest around.
What phone plans does Kogan Mobile offer?
Kogan keeps it simple with just four pre-paid phone plans. The plans are available in 31-periods, or you can pay for 365 upfront for a discount, as shown. Across both periods, data, call and text allowances renew every 31 days:
31-day | 365-day plans
- $15 Plan: 1.5GB data & unlimited calls & texts to NZ/OZ | $160 per year (= $13.59 per 31 days)
- $25 Plan: 4GB data & unlimited calls & texts to NZ/OZ | $250 per year (= $21.23 per 31 days)
- $35 Plan: 15GB data & unlimited calls & texts to NZ/OZ | $330 per year (= $28.03 per 31 days)
- $55 Plan: 32GB data & unlimited calls & texts to NZ/OZ | $490 per year (= $41.62 per 31 days)
As you can see there are considerable savings to be had if you sign up for a year-long deal. However, there are a couple of things to consider before signing up to Kogan's 365-day plans:
- You'll need to pay the entire cost upfront
- If you cancel your 365-day plan at any time, you'll forfeit your unused credit
Note: before you can sign up for Kogan Mobile, you have to order a Kogan sim card for $5.
Are Kogan's pre-paid plans value for money?
Compared to other prepaid deals in the market, all of Kogan's mobile plans stand out as being excellent value for money.
Notably, it's the only prepaid mobile provider to earn 5 Stars for Value for Money in our latest Prepaid Mobile Award.
However, as Kogan is a no-frills provider, it does not offer the benefits available from some other telcos, such as free Spotify and free data.
Also Kogan is an online company, so does not offer the type of customer service available from telcos with physical stores.
